Ingredient Additions & Substitutions

Feel free to experiment with this easy beef and broccoli recipe to make it your own. You can amp up the nutrition by adding crunchy water chestnuts or sliced bell peppers, injecting a fresh burst of color and texture. For those who love a bit more heat, a pinch of red pepper flakes or a splash of chili garlic sauce will bring a thrilling kick. If flank steak isn’t at hand, top sirloin or even skirt steak are excellent substitutes that remain tender and flavorful. To switch up the sauce profile, try substituting hoisin sauce for oyster sauce to add a subtly sweet and tangy dimension. Those looking to acquaint themselves with a healthier twist may swap brown sugar for honey or maple syrup, which provide natural sweetness with added depth. Step 1: Whisk Together the Flavorful Sauce

Combine low-sodium soy sauce, oyster sauce, brown sugar, cornstarch, beef broth, and sesame oil in a bowl. Use a whisk to blend everything into a smooth, tempting sauce that will coat the beef and broccoli perfectly. Setting this aside prepares you to add intense flavor in the later steps.

Step 2: Sear the Beef to Perfection

Heat 1 tablespoon of vegetable oil in a large skillet or wok over high heat. Place the thinly sliced flank steak in a single layer and sear for 2-3 minutes on each side until browned beautifully. Remove the beef and set aside, preserving those rich, juicy edges.

Step 3: Stir-Fry the Broccoli with Aromatics

Add the remaining oil to the skillet. Toss in the broccoli florets, stir-frying for 3-4 minutes until they become bright green and tender-crisp. Add minced garlic and grated ginger, cooking for just 30 seconds to release their hypnotic aromas without overwhelming the dish.

Step 4: Combine and Simmer with the Sauce

Return the seared beef to the skillet, then pour the prepared sauce over everything. Toss carefully to coat the ingredients. Cook for another 2-3 minutes until the sauce thickens and lavishly glazes the beef and broccoli, creating a visually stunning and flavorful masterpiece.

Pro Tips & Tricks

For a terrific result, ensure your beef is sliced thinly against the grain to maximize tenderness and flavor absorption. Preheat your skillet or wok well to get an excellent sear on the meat, locking in its juices quickly. When stir-frying broccoli, avoid overcooking to preserve its vibrant green color and crispness, which create a delightful contrast. Try marinating the beef briefly with a teaspoon of soy sauce and a pinch of cornstarch before cooking to add an extra layer of flavor and promote a velvety texture. Lastly, avoid overcrowding your pan, which steams ingredients instead of searing them, reducing that coveted caramelized taste. Storage Instructions

Store leftover Easy Beef and Broccoli in an airtight container and refrigerate promptly. It keeps wonderfully fresh for up to 3 days, retaining its flavors for delicious next-day meals. When reheating, warm gently in a skillet over medium heat or microwave until just heated through, preventing the broccoli from becoming overly soft. This practical approach preserves the texture and taste, providing a convenient and delightful way to enjoy this appealing dish again. Avoid freezing as the texture of the broccoli may change, impacting the overall mouthfeel negatively.

FAQs

Can I use a different cut of beef for this recipe?

Absolutely! While flank steak is preferred for its tenderness and flavor, you can use top sirloin, skirt steak, or even ribeye if you prefer. Just be sure to slice the meat thinly against the grain to keep it tender and allow it to cook evenly.

Is it possible to make this recipe gluten-free?

Yes, you can easily make gluten-free adjustments by substituting the soy sauce with tamari or a gluten-free soy sauce alternative. Additionally, check oyster sauce labels or use coconut aminos for a safe gluten-free option. These changes maintain the savory depth without compromising taste.

How do I keep the broccoli crunchy?

To retain the broccoli’s crispness, stir-fry it for just 3-4 minutes until it turns bright green and tender-crisp. Avoid overcooking or steaming by using high heat and quick cooking methods, which preserve its appealing texture and lively color.

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 lb (450g) flank steak, thinly sliced against the grain
  • 3 cups broccoli florets
  • 3 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 tbsp fresh ginger, grated
  • 2 tbsp vegetable oil, divided
  • 1/3 cup low-sodium soy sauce
  • 2 tbsp oyster sauce
  • 1 tbsp brown sugar
  • 1 tbsp cornstarch
  • 1/2 cup beef broth
  • 1 tsp sesame oil

Instructions

  1. Whisk together all sauce ingredients in a bowl. Set aside.
  2. Heat 1 tbsp oil in a large skillet or wok over high heat.
  3. Add sliced beef in a single layer and sear 2-3 minutes per side until browned. Remove and set aside.
  4. Add remaining oil to the skillet. Stir-fry broccoli florets for 3-4 minutes until bright green and tender-crisp.
  5. Add garlic and ginger, cook 30 seconds until fragrant.
  6. Return beef to the pan. Pour sauce over everything.
  7. Toss and cook 2-3 minutes until sauce thickens and coats the beef and broccoli.
  8. Serve immediately over steamed rice.

Notes

For a soy sauce substitute, use tamari or coconut aminos for gluten-free options. Oyster sauce can be replaced with hoisin sauce for a sweeter twist. Prepare steak slices and sauce ahead to save time. Store leftovers in an airtight container for up to 3 days. To prevent tough beef, slice thinly against the grain and avoid overcooking. If sauce is too thick, add a splash of beef broth to loosen it.
